... going somewhere. The paragraph goes on to describe Karim? depression at the beginning of the novel. He says that he doesn't? know why he? depressed but part of this must lie in living in the apparently stagnant suburbs. He then goes on to ?hen one day everything changed. In the morning things was one way and by bedtime another. I was seventeen. (All of this on page 3) This evening features a visit to Eva Kay? house- foreshadowing his move to the house in Chapter Six and Seven. Some of the turmoil Karim feels at the massive change in his family life is characterized in his distress and confusion over the change in geography.
